## Deployment

Matchstone's matcher is GC-sensitive. Long pauses stall order pairing and trip the liveness probe, so we pin heap size, use the low-latency collector, and cap nursery growth. Do not deploy with default JVM flags; last week's incident came from exactly that. For the sync: pauses are back under 40ms at p99. Deploy with the configuration shown below.

deployment values, kajep-kageg:
[praix]
host = praix.paliqcorp.corp
user = praix_svc
database = praix_prod

Internal Memo — Partner Term Sheet Review
To: Finance Team, Quillon Dynamics

We have received a revised term sheet from Stavebrook Ventures regarding the proposed co-development of the Halcyon platform. Key changes: milestone payments shifted to delivery acceptance, a tighter exclusivity window, and a capped indemnity. Please model cash-flow implications under both the base and delayed-milestone scenarios, and flag any covenant conflicts by Wednesday. The confidential planning note appended below provides the necessary context.

confidential, kajof-tahof: The pricing group signed off on a budget of $491.8 million for Project Casvan.

**Leadership Review Briefing — Garnett Stores Pilot**

Sales leads, quick download ahead of Thursday's review. The Garnett Stores pilot has been running eight weeks across their Duncraigh region: our Larkspur loyalty platform is live in nine shops, redemption rates are roughly double their old scheme, and their buying team is warm. Main friction is till integration time — about three days per store, which they want halved. They're hinting at a national deal. Where we want to take this is outlined below.

internal memo for bahap-yagug: Headcount on the Ulaix team goes from 3 to 100 by the end of January. Gross margin on Ulaix came in at 10 percent against a plan of 15 percent.

# Bounce Processor Limits — Mailwright

This page covers the quotas Mailwright's bounce processor enforces per sending domain. Hard bounces suppress addresses immediately; soft bounces accumulate against a rolling window before suppression. When a customer asks why mail stopped, check the window counters first — they reset daily. The thresholds and window sizes currently in effect are as follows.

tuning table, bagag-tahop:
THRESHOLDS = {
    "eliael": 792,
    "pramir": 583,
    "belys": 750,
    "ulaax": 865,
    "holiel": 732,
    "lamath": 599,
    "julwyn": 683,
}